Apple to Have Huge Christmas
Apple’s iPhone 6 and iPhone 6 Plus have done huge business for the company so far, selling tens of millions of units in the short months since the handsets launched in September. They have smashed sales records and expelled any fears of Cupertino falling behind in China, while they have also found all this success when closest rival Samsung is struggling.

However, as impressive as the iPhone 6 / 6 Plus launch windows has been, it is nothing compared to what the holiday season is going to bring. When the Thanksgiving Holidays kick in at the end of this month and the Christmas Holidays play out in December, the iPhone 6 will have nailed down its dominance as easily the most sought after smartphone on the market. In fact, Apple may not have made enough units.

It is widely thought that Apple prepared 85 million units of the handsets to last from the late September launch to December 31st. However, more than 40 million of those units have gone and even conservative analyst predictions say Apple will sell up to 60 million iPhone units over the busy holiday period. So, either Cupertino built more devices or the iPhone will get scarce this Christmas.

It is thought that through the fourth quarter Apple could sell as many as 75 million units of its all-conquering smartphone. The iPhone 6 is already the best-selling smartphone of the year, something it achieved in less than a month. Indeed, by the end of the year the iPhone would have sold more units than the LG G3, HTC One, Moto X, Samsung Galaxy S5, Galaxy Note 4, and the Sony Xperia Z3 combined.
